Elephant Chawang's sperm count good
By Wong Mun Wai, Channel NewsAsia | Posted: 11 April 2007 2355 hrs

 
 
Photos  of

   
 


SINGAPORE: Singapore Zoo's elephant Chawang has had his semen quality tested and results showed his sperm count is good.

Chawang, the largest and heaviest animal at the zoo, is almost 3 metres tall and weighs 3,480kg.

He has already sired three elephants.

Zoos in Australia, like the one in Perth, have shown interest in taking samples of Chawang's semen to impregnate their female Asian elephants.

But no plans have been confirmed yet. - CNA/ir
